回覆列表
-
1 # 小小程式設計師玲兒
-
2 # 教育和科技
這個應該不會,就算是SSM也是很傳統的開發框架,不用太擔心。至於你說的主流技術不應該侷限在諸如SSM框架之類的。而應該關注一些新的技術發展方向、一些原理性的東西,這些才是最終成為技術大牛之路。
如果你現在的企業發展等前景都不錯,可以過去。隨著企業的發展,他們的技術路線應該也會有所變化。如果你有興趣,後續可以往大資料、人工智慧等方向發展。當然這個看個人,而且這個東西也沒有覺得的好與壞。適合自己的就是最好的。
-
3 # IT程式設計分享
應該是問一問你的未來發展方向,到底喜歡做什麼。如果剛工作的,最好少跳槽,在一個公司沉下心工作個四五年,在這個期間深入研究,達到一個架構師的級別,深入研究主流開源框架原始碼,具備開發公司級別公共元件、有能力寫一些開源框架或參與一些開源框架的開發工作。
百戰程式設計師IT問題專業解答
當前Java語言在IT網際網路行業內依然有非常廣泛的應用,雖然Java語言自身的抽象程度比較高,而且Java語言自身也比較重,但是由於Java語言穩定的效能表現,以及較強的擴充套件性和安全性,使得采用Java語言來進行專案開發,能夠在一定程度上降低開發風險。從技術體系結構來看,Java語言的技術生態是比較成熟和完善的,這也是很多平臺類產品開發都更願意採用Java語言的重要原因。
從當前大的發展趨勢來看,雲計算、大資料、物聯網、區塊鏈和人工智慧等技術領域會有比較廣闊的發展空間,而Java語言在這些領域都或多或少有所應用,尤其在雲計算、大資料和區塊鏈領域,Java語言的應用還是非常普遍的。從大的發展趨勢來看,對於Java程式設計師來說,未來可以重點關注一下大資料技術,Java在大資料領域的應用前景還是非常廣闊的。
從Java語言自身的發展趨勢來看,在解決了模組化問題之後,Java語言未來將在三個方面進一步提升,其一是擴充套件Java語言的應用邊界,這一點一直以來就是Java語言在進行版本迭代時的重點,其二是進一步相容更多的程式設計方式,其三是提升語言自身的效能。
在產業網際網路時代,程式語言的作用會進一步得到體現,更多的技術人員和普通職場人都需要透過掌握一門程式語言來提升自身的工作能力,由於Java語言自身的難度比較高,所以Java語言往往是專業技術人員的工具,而Java語言要想進一步擴充套件自身的應用邊界,還需要結合具體的應用場景來進行最佳化。隨著當前諸多企業紛紛實現業務上雲,未來Java語言在雲計算和大資料領域的應用場景會非常多,從這個角度來看,未來職場人要想在雲計算和大資料領域獲得賦能,應該重視Java語言的學習。